Amtrak's Acela seats to be upcycled into luxury bags
Progressive Railroading
10/17/2018

> Amtrak has partnered with People for Urban Progress (PUP) to
> repurpose Acela Express seat covers into luxury leather bags.
>
> An Indianapolis-based nonprofit, PUP expects to roll out about 2,500
> bags over the next 10 to 12 months as the seat coverings are
> repurposed. The first products will include tote bags, backpacks and
> "dopp kits" or toiletry bags. PUP designers are hand-crafting all the
> bags.
>
> "One of the main objectives of this upcycling project is to divert as
> much waste from landfills as possible," said Amtrak Senior
> Sustainability Manager Kara Angotti in a press release. "We have set
> a corporate recycling target of 20 percent by 2020 and this project
> will help us advance closer to achieving that goal. This is a unique
> opportunity to explore the extended value in our trash and to focus
> on ensuring we consider what happens to our materials at the end of
> their useful life."
>
> The project marks PUP's first national endeavor and a new initiative
> for Amtrak. The bags will retail from $75 to $750, according to PUP.
>
> Amtrak's Acela Express service operates between Washington, D.C., and
> Boston.
